JOB SUMMARY

The selected candidate will become a member of a multidisciplinary training team and will be responsible for the client website used for the delivery of a comprehensive technical training program. The WEB Developer will:

  • Collaborate with other ISDs/Training Developers in a SAFe Agile framework environment in designing and developing classroom learning solutions to prepare students to carry out their mission working with user interfaces.
  • Work independently in maintaining a client website for DoD and Government users worldwide for operability and user experience (UX) using HTML.
  • Collaborate with training team members to create and manage interactive software simulations used for training.
  • Work with other developers to develop interactive HTML-based modules from CBT storyboards.
  • Organize and manage large file repositories to prepare web components for deployment.
  • Monitor changes to commercially sourced web platforms and applications to determine the impact they could have on delivered products.

P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Prepare graphics and multimedia materials, create and edit multilayer images, and composite images.
  • Create and manage web pages using HTML.
  • Write and edit JavaScript code.
  • Write and edit CSS code.
  • Document in detail proprietary code and routines.
  • Employ search engine indexer tools.
  • Capture screenshots from a client interface.
  • Test website for SCORM conformance.
  • Devise and implement solutions to resolve performance issues.
  • Initiate system and process innovations.
  • Apply best practices for documentation and file management.
  • Conform to policy and internal style-guide standards.

BASIC QUALIFICATIONS

  • TS/SCI with polygraph required.
  • Bachelor’s degree in web management or a related discipline and at least 8 years of relevant experience. Additional experience may be substituted for a degree.
  • At least 5 years of experience managing websites and creating graphics.
  • At least 5 years of experience writing and editing HTML code.
  • Experience writing and maintaining CSS code.
  • Experience writing and maintaining JavaScript code.
  • Experience working with Instructional Designers.
  • Must be able to schedule and prioritize tasks to meet deadlines in a fast-paced environment.

P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S

  • Advanced knowledge of graphic design software such as Adobe Photoshop/Illustrator or equivalent.
  • Experience with video editor tools like Camtasia.
  • Advanced knowledge of web publishing applications like Adobe Dreamweaver with JavaScript, and CSS in use.
